acm-header
Sign In

Communications of the ACM

Blogroll


Refine your search:
datePast Year
subjectComputer Applications
bg-corner

Lego Computer Science: Turing Machines Part 1: the tape
From CS4FN (Computer Science For Fun)

Lego Computer Science: Turing Machines Part 1: the tape

by Paul Curzon, Queen Mary University of London It it possible to make a working computer out of lego and you do not even have to pay for an expensive robot Mindstorm...

Singing bird – a human choir, singing birdsong
From CS4FN (Computer Science For Fun)

Singing bird – a human choir, singing birdsong

Dawn Chorus: Marcus Coates and Geoff Sample recorded birdsong, then slowed it down and got people to sing it (then sped it up again!).

Eggheads: helping us to visualise objects and classes
From CS4FN (Computer Science For Fun)

Eggheads: helping us to visualise objects and classes

by Daniel Gill, Queen Mary University of London Past CS4FN articles have explored object-oriented programming through self-aware pizza and Strictly Come Dancing...

Ethics – What would you do? Part 2: answers
From CS4FN (Computer Science For Fun)

Ethics – What would you do? Part 2: answers

Answers to our ethical dilemma quiz from yesterday.

Ethics – What would you do?
From CS4FN (Computer Science For Fun)

Ethics – What would you do?

An ethical dilemma quiz with answers coming tomorrow.

Equality, diversity and inclusion in the R Project: collaborative community coding & curating with Dr Heather Turner
From CS4FN (Computer Science For Fun)

Equality, diversity and inclusion in the R Project: collaborative community coding & curating with Dr Heather Turner

Find out about Dr Heather Turner's EPSRC project to increase diversity and representation in software (R programming language) and about the role of Research Software...

Tonight, 8pm on BBC Four – the first of three Christmas Lectures for young people on Artificial Intelligence
From CS4FN (Computer Science For Fun)

Tonight, 8pm on BBC Four – the first of three Christmas Lectures for young people on Artificial Intelligence

If you're near a television or computer at 8pm you can watch the first of this year's Christmas Lectures, all about artificial intelligence.

CS4FN Advent Calendar – Day 25 bonus Christmas crackers: have you ever seen this cracker joke?
From CS4FN (Computer Science For Fun)

CS4FN Advent Calendar – Day 25 bonus Christmas crackers: have you ever seen this cracker joke?

If you’re pulling a Christmas cracker today look out for this now famous but fairly puzzling ‘joke’ – Q: What kind of cough medicine does Dracula take?A: Con medicine...

CS4FN Advent 2023 – Day 23: Father Christmas – checking his list, spotting the errors
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 23: Father Christmas – checking his list, spotting the errors

Our CS4FN Christmas Computing Advent Calendar has now been running for 23 days! That’s one post every single day, matching a computing-themed blog post to the image...

CS4FN Advent 2023: wreaths and rope memory – weave your own space age computer
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023: wreaths and rope memory – weave your own space age computer

Each day throughout December (until Christmas Day) we’ll be publishing a computing-themed blog post suggested by the picture on the front of our Advent Calendar...

CS4FN Advent 2023 – Day 21: stars and celestial navigation
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 21: stars and celestial navigation

Every day from the 1st to the 25th of December this blog will publish a Christmas Computing post, as part of our CS4FN Christmas Computing Advent Calendar. On the...

CS4FN Advent 2023 – Day 19: jingle bells or warning bells? Avoiding computer scams
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 19: jingle bells or warning bells? Avoiding computer scams

It’s Day 19 of the CS4FN Christmas Computing Advent Calendar. Every day throughout Advent we’ll be doing our best to publish a computing-themed post that relates...

CS4FN Advent 2023 – Day 18: cracker or hacker? Cyber security
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 18: cracker or hacker? Cyber security

It’s Day 18 of the CS4FN Christmas Computing Advent Calendar. We’ve been posting a computing-themed article linked to the picture on the ‘front’ of the advent calendar...

CS4FN Advent 2023 – Day 17: pocket-switching networked reindeer
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 17: pocket-switching networked reindeer

Gosh, Christmas is just around the corner! It’s Day 17 of the CS4FN Christmas Computing Advent Calendar and we’ve posted a blog post every day since 1 December,...

CS4FN Advent 2023 – Day 16: candy cane or walking aid: designing for everyone, human computer interaction
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 16: candy cane or walking aid: designing for everyone, human computer interaction

Welcome to Day 16 of the CS4FN Christmas Computing Advent Calendar in which we’re posting a blog post every day in December until (and including) Christmas Day....

CS4FN Advent 2023 – Day 15: a candle: optical fibre, optical illusions
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 15: a candle: optical fibre, optical illusions

After yesterday’s tinsel image inspiring a cable / broadband speeds themed post, today’s CS4FN Christmas Computing Advent Calendar picture of a candle has of course...

CS4FN Advent 2023 – Day 14: Why is your internet so slow + a festive kriss-kross puzzle
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 14: Why is your internet so slow + a festive kriss-kross puzzle

Today’s CS4FN Christmas Computing Advent Calendar is showing a picture of shiny tinsel, which reminds me a bit of computer cables. At least, enough to theme this...

CS4FN Advent 2023 – Day 13: woolly hat: warming versus cooling
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 13: woolly hat: warming versus cooling

Welcome to Day 3 of the CS4FN Christmas Computing Advent Calendar. The picture on the ‘box’ was a woolly bobble / pom-pom hat, so let’s see if we can find something...

CS4FN Advent 2023 – Day 12: Computer Memory – Molecules and Memristors
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 12: Computer Memory – Molecules and Memristors

Computer memory molecular style, memristors, maths puzzle answer and a “20 questions” activity Remember remember the 24th of December – as that’s the day to hang...

CS4FN Advent 2023 – Day 11: the proof of the pudding… mathematical proof
From CS4FN (Computer Science For Fun)

CS4FN Advent 2023 – Day 11: the proof of the pudding… mathematical proof

A mathematical proof and a maths puzzle (but no hard sums, promise). Thank you to everyone who’s been reading our Advent Calendar and said nice things about itContinue...
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account